Adrián Portelli knows that it takes money to make money.

The businessman and luxury car enthusiast, also known as the ‘Lambo Guy’, has revealed the staggering sum he has invested in multi-billion dollar company LMCT+ over the past eight years.

“Over those eight years and 100 million dollars spent, yes, we have been able to build a brand, we have been able to build trust with the public, we have a database of millions, of the millions of people that we have been with.” capable of achieving,” he said in a social media post.

“Our pixels, our social networks, are so warm that we can just throw money at them and they will convert,” Portelli continued.

‘We have access to features with these social media platforms and teams that you wouldn’t even know existed.

“So for anyone who thinks one day they’re going to wake up and say, ‘Hey, I have a good idea, I’m going to start a new gift company,’ guys, that didn’t happen overnight.”

It comes after Portelli was named one of Australia’s richest people.

He has reached position 115 on The List (Australia’s 250 richest) with an estimated fortune of $1.3 billion obtained thanks to his promotions company LMCT+.

The lottery business offers its members generous prizes, including luxury homes, cars and cash in monthly drawings using a loophole.

Subscribers also get exclusive offers from over 1,000 partners, including Beaurepaires, Patriot Campers and Prestige Autoworks.

It has around 100,000 customers who pay a monthly subscription.

LMCT+ operates as a “business promotion”, a type of lottery originally designed to help businesses attract customers by rewarding them with prizes, under a license issued in New South Wales.

Portelli has also made several appearances on Channel Nine’s The Block, where he buys houses to give to his LMCT+ members.

Portelli’s $1.3 billion fortune has also been earned through his assets. The businessman has a particular penchant for fast cars and expensive properties.

He made headlines last May after he used a crane to lift his $2 million Maclaren hypercar up to his $39 million penthouse on Melbourne’s Southbank.

Rich Lister previously admitted that he had lost count of the number of rare limited-edition sports cars he owns, but he believes it is around 50.

The millionaire investor’s extensive real estate portfolio also includes Melbourne’s most expensive apartment – a $39 million penthouse in the city.

Despite his bold taste, Portelli came from humble beginnings.

He dropped out of college to work in his father’s truck repair business before moving to Los Angeles to launch a celebrity limo service.

While struggling to pay his rent, he found an online roommate who helped him develop several successful apps, which he then sold.

“I’m always humble because it wasn’t easy to get to where I got,” Portelli told the Australian Financial Review last October.

‘Every day I woke up thinking about being successful. I was just consumed by it. It was a bit of a loner, man, and it used to motivate me and keep pushing me.
